When your sump lid shows signs of rust, addressing the problem quickly can prevent costly repairs and maintain your system's integrity. We'll guide you through proven methods to tackle this common issue effectively and extend your sump lid's lifespan.

First, we need to perform a thorough rust assessment to determine the extent of damage. Surface rust often responds well to treatment, but severe deterioration might compromise structural integrity, necessitating replacement. We recommend examining the entire lid surface, paying special attention to edges and contact points where moisture tends to accumulate.

Before applying any treatments, proper cleaning and preparation are essential. We'll want to remove all loose rust and debris using a wire brush or die grinder. This step creates a clean surface that guarantees better adhesion for subsequent treatments. Don't skip this vital preparation phase, as it greatly impacts the effectiveness of rust converters and protective coatings.

Speaking of rust converters, products like Vactan or Hammerite Kurust are excellent choices for treating corroded areas. These solutions chemically transform rust into a stable compound that prevents further corrosion. We'll want to apply the converter evenly across all affected areas, following the manufacturer's instructions carefully for best results.

After the rust converter has done its job, sealing and painting become our next priority. We recommend using a high-quality protective coating designed specifically for metal surfaces. This additional layer creates a moisture barrier that helps prevent future rust formation. Apply multiple thin coats rather than one thick layer for better coverage and durability. Regular float switch checks during maintenance can help identify potential rust issues early on.

Sometimes, despite our best efforts at restoration, replacement consideration becomes necessary. If we notice extensive rust damage or if repairs would cost more than a new lid, investing in a replacement might be the most cost-effective solution. Modern sump lids often come with improved corrosion prevention features, making them a worthy long-term investment.

How to Clean Rust off Sump Pump?

Let's start with wire brushing to remove loose rust, then apply chemical rust removers or vinegar. After sanding, we'll use a rust converter and finish with protective coatings to prevent future corrosion.

How Do You Seal a Sump Pump Lid?

Let's seal your sump lid effectively using quality foam gaskets and waterproof sealant around the perimeter. We'll secure it with eight screws, add caulk for extra protection, and regularly check for wear and tear.

Why Is My Sump Pump Rusty?

We often see rust on sump pumps due to constant moisture exposure and environmental factors. Poor maintenance, lack of corrosion prevention, and high humidity can greatly impact your pump's lifespan, especially with metal components.

Should a Sump Pump Pit Be Cleaned?

Like a heart needs clean arteries, we must regularly clean our sump pit to maintain efficiency, prevent clogs, and guarantee proper drainage. Annual cleaning keeps our pump running smoothly and eliminates unpleasant odors.
